In organic chemistry, a carbonyl group is a functional group with the formula C=O, composed of a carbon atom double-bonded to an oxygen atom, and it is divalent at the C atom. WebIR Spectroscopy Tutorial: Alkenes. Alkenes are compounds that have a carbon-carbon double bond, –C=C–. The stretching vibration of the C=C bond usually gives rise to a moderate band in the region 1680-1640 cm -1. WebA functional group that contains a carbon atom linked to double bonded atom of oxygen is called carbonyl group. An organic compound that shows the presence of carbonyl group is called as carbonyl compound. In inorganic chemistry (or) in an organometallic complex, carbonyl also denotes carbon monoxide as a ligand. WebInternal C=O bonds are found in positively charged oxonium ions.
